Weather was nice - not as hot as it is hear today (we are in Essex) but shorts & t-shirt weather, seemed hotter in the late afternoon early evening - we wore light jackets to breakfast (8am).
Monday to Wednesday the crowds were very light my hubby walked on both RR & Space mountain! :banana: . No longer than 1/2 hour for anything. Thursday & Friday it did get busier & tickets for Lion King went very quickly!.

The Lion Ling has been so popular that they now issue tickets out 1 hour before the show (you dont have to pay) but the que's started at about 10.45 for the 12.00 show - once you have the tickets you can go away & come back at the time of the show (does tht make sense?)
